The rules writing process is open to the public. The public is welcome to take part in helping us write rules. Rules are also known as regulations, Washington Administrative Code, or WAC. The rule-making process includes public notices and workshops, and usually a public hearing before a rule becomes final.

Recently Completed Rules
The Department of Health filed a CR-103 rule package (PDF) on February 20, 2025, for chapter 246-810 WAC to implement several bills. The amendments established coursework requirements for new agency affiliated counselor (AAC) credentials, established that student interns are eligible for the registered AAC credential, and added federally qualified health centers as an approved practice setting for AACs after January 1, 2028. These rules are effective July 1, 2025.
